Output fbbdc831ad826b27dac21ed17f8f0ff7849024fac8a2ca241b46082e696f37ea:33

value
2614503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da66deaa96042ea019c568fb70728c1655e4b62 OP_EQUAL
address
34PntpcCqvFGUD41ww9eyf4jeGUUDwHknf
transaction
fbbdc831ad826b27dac21ed17f8f0ff7849024fac8a2ca241b46082e696f37ea
spent
true